2 Samuel 7:24

For thou hast confirmed to thyself thy people Israel [to be] a
people unto thee for ever
So long as they were obedient to him, and observed his laws and statutes, and abode by his worship and ordinances, otherwise he would write a "loammi" on them, as he has, see ( Hosea 1:9 ) ;

and thou, Lord, art become their God;
their covenant God, they having avouched him to be their God, and he having avouched them to be his people, ( Deuteronomy 26:17 Deuteronomy 26:18 ) .
